Cartier Art Deco period 18kt yellow gold open-face circular EWC movement pocket watch.
The rear side has an engraved family crest.
The movement is signed European Watch and Clock Company. In the early 1920s Cartier formed a joint company with Edward Jaeger (of Jaeger-LeCoultre) to produce movements solely for Cartier. The European Watch & Clock Co. company was born, Cartier continued to use movements from other makers including Vacheron Constantin, Audemars Piguet, Movado and LeCoultre.
